ConsoleReaderOutputStream
public
class
ConsoleReaderOutputStream
extends Object
java.lang.Object | |
↳ | com.android.tradefed.command.console.ConsoleReaderOutputStream |
Um OutputStream que pode ser usado para fazer com que System.out.print()
funcione bem com a
LineReader
unfinishedLine do usuário.
Em testes de desempenho triviais, essa classe não teve um impacto mensurável no desempenho.
Resumo
Construtores públicos | |
---|---|
ConsoleReaderOutputStream(LineReader reader)
|
Métodos públicos | |
---|---|
LineReader
|
getConsoleReader()
Receber a instância de LineReader que estamos usando internamente |
void
|
write(byte[] b, int off, int len)
|
void
|
write(int b)
|
Construtores públicos
ConsoleReaderOutputStream
public ConsoleReaderOutputStream (LineReader reader)
Parâmetros | |
---|---|
reader |
LineReader |
Métodos públicos
getConsoleReader
public LineReader getConsoleReader ()
Receber a instância do LineReader que estamos usando internamente
Retorna | |
---|---|
LineReader |
escrever
public void write (byte[] b, int off, int len)
Parâmetros | |
---|---|
b |
byte |
off |
int |
len |
int |
gravação
public void write (int b)
Parâmetros | |
---|---|
b |
int |